Connecticut Gives Taxpayers a “Fresh Start”

by Chanel Christoff Davis in Amnesty, Connecticut, Sales Tax

Connecticut- Governor Dannel P. Malloy announced earlier this year a voluntary “Fresh Start” program targeting unreported and underreported tax obligations due by 12/31/16. Texas Extends Hotel Tax Relief

by Chanel Christoff Davis in Community Involvement, Sales Tax, Texas

Texas– Suspensions for state and local hotel occupancy taxes for Hurricane Harvey victims and relief workers have now been extended through October 23, 2017.  Previously, the suspension issued by Governor Abbot was applied from September 7 through September 22, 2017.
